Face sculpting, also known as facial massage or facial contouring, is a holistic approach that not only enhances facial features but also induces a profound sense of relaxation and serenity. This therapeutic practice involves gentle manipulation of the facial muscles and tissues to release tension, improve circulation, and promote lymphatic drainage. Through a combination of massage techniques, pressure points, and specialized tools, facial sculpting aims to rejuvenate the skin, lift sagging muscles, and restore balance to the face.
